Monrovia City Mayor, Jefferson Koijee Accused Of Funding The July 26 Violence

Jefferson T. Koijee, Monrovia City Mayor

As public outcry of the July 26 violence that led several members of the University of Liberia based Student Unification Party (SUP) brutalized by the CDC-COP protesters, the Movement for Economic Empowerment has accused the Monrovia City Mayor Jefferson Koijee of funding July 26 Counter-Protest.

In a press released in Monrovia by MOVEE, said the Monrovia City Mayor is noted always for supporting violence, especially having a history traced to participating in Liberia’s 14 years of civil war.

With the organization is calling the Ministry of Justice to take seize of the matter by ensuring all those involvedΒ  into the bloody clash with the students face the full weight of the law, including Mayor Koijee who allegedly sponsored the attack against the student peaceful gathering on July 26.

MOVEE also expressed disdain in the acts of violence that ensued on Tuesday, July 26, 2022 against protesting students of the Student Unification Party, perpetrated by CDC-Council of Patriots.

But according to the OK FM Liberia, effort to contact the Monrovia City Mayor proved unsuccessful as he is said to have remained tight lipped
